摘要
以磷酸介质中亚硝酸根催化溴酸钾氧化溴酚蓝为指示反应 ,通过条件选择 ,建立了催化光度法测定痕量亚硝酸根的新方法 .在 90℃恒温水浴中加热反应 1 0min ,测定亚硝酸根的线性范围为 0 .0 1~ 0 .6 0 μg/2 5mL ,测定下限低达 8× 1 0 -11g/mL.所拟定分析方法已直接应用于环境水样中超痕量亚硝酸根的测定 .
A new catalytic method is for determination of trace nitrite. It is based on the catalytic action of nitrite on a new indicative reaction the oxidation deceleration of bromophenol blue by potassium bromate in dilute phosphoric acid. The reaction rate is monitored spectro-photometrically by measuring the absorbency at 600 nm after quenching the reaction with sodium hydroxide. Fixing the reaction time as 10 min, a calibration graph from 0.01 to 0.60 μg / 25 mL of nitrite and a detection limit of 8 ×10 -11 g /mL is obtained. The proposed method has been applied successfully to the determination of trace nitrite in some natural waters.
